• Open Menu Close Menu
  • Apple
  • Shopping Bag
  • Apple
  • Mac
  • iPad
  • iPhone
  • Watch
  • TV
  • Music
  • Support
  • Search apple.com
  • Shopping Bag

Lists

Open Menu Close Menu
  • Terms and Conditions
  • Lists hosted on this site
  • Email the Postmaster
  • Tips for posting to public mailing lists
Programatically creating NSMenu?
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Programatically creating NSMenu?


  • Subject: Programatically creating NSMenu?
  • From: Daqi Pei <email@hidden>
  • Date: Wed, 8 Apr 2009 21:13:39 +0800

I've been trying to create a Cocoa GUI application without IB. Everything
works fine except for the NSMenu.
After digging over the internet I found a solution from '
http://lapcatsoftware.com/blog/2007/06', by using some undocumented methods
and member variables.

I succeeded in creating the application, and what I found interesting is, it
seems that if I run the application from Terminal, no menu
would be shown (the Windows still work fine). The only way to have the menus
working properly is to create an Application.app directory structure, and
run from Finder. Apps with static Nibs work fine both running from Terminal
and Finder.

Again I'm doing this only to understand how the system works. Did I miss
something or it's just the way the framework was designed?



Regards,
Daqi Pei
_______________________________________________

Cocoa-dev mailing list (email@hidden)

Please do not post admin requests or moderator comments to the list.
Contact the moderators at cocoa-dev-admins(at)lists.apple.com

Help/Unsubscribe/Update your Subscription:

This email sent to email@hidden

  • Follow-Ups:
    • Re: Programatically creating NSMenu?
      • From: Uli Kusterer <email@hidden>
    • Re: Programatically creating NSMenu?
      • From: Jeff Johnson <email@hidden>
    • Re: Programatically creating NSMenu?
      • From: m <email@hidden>
    • Re: Programatically creating NSMenu?
      • From: Kyle Sluder <email@hidden>
    • Re: Programatically creating NSMenu?
      • From: Keary Suska <email@hidden>
  • Prev by Date: [MEETING] Toronto Area Cocoa & WebObjects Developer Group - April 14
  • Next by Date: Re: Storing bundle loaded main class instances in NSArray
  • Previous by thread: [MEETING] Toronto Area Cocoa & WebObjects Developer Group - April 14
  • Next by thread: Re: Programatically creating NSMenu?
  • Index(es):
    • Date
    • Thread